15:03:07 #startmeeting manila 15:03:07 Meeting started Thu Jan 20 15:03:07 2022 UTC and is due to finish in 60 minutes. The chair is gouthamr. Information about MeetBot at http://wiki.debian.org/MeetBot. 15:03:07 Useful Commands: #action #agreed #help #info #idea #link #topic #startvote. 15:03:07 The meeting name has been set to 'manila' 15:03:17 hi 15:03:24 courtesy ping: ganso vkmc dviroel carloss felipe_rodrigues ecsantos vhari fabiooliveira 15:03:28 o/ 15:03:29 o/ 15:03:30 o/ 15:03:32 o/ 15:03:32 o/ 15:03:44 o/ 15:03:54 hi 15:03:55 hi there, sorry for the booting delay 15:03:59 o/ 15:04:20 o/ 15:04:31 o/ 15:04:43 hi 15:04:46 o/ 15:04:52 #topic Announcements 15:05:13 this weekend's our new driver proposal deadline for the yoga cycle 15:05:20 #link https://releases.openstack.org/yoga/schedule.html 15:06:21 there are a few pending driver patches, and one of the driver maintainers informed me that he's having trouble getting their CI system up and running 15:08:26 they're consulting with folks in infra and software factory at the moment 15:08:35 its possible they'll seek an exception if their CI system is not functional by the weekend... 15:08:53 just out of interest what are the issues with SF - we are seeing some with a new CI we are building 15:10:01 simondodsley: i don't really understand them, i could loop you in, i meant to forward their email to openstack-discuss so we could have a wider (and more helpful) audience 15:10:34 simondodsley: from what i can tell, they are having troubles triggering their pipeline and basing their job on the upstream job 15:10:46 gouthamr: yes, please loop me in. We are looking for someone to help out - we might even pay :) 15:11:07 ^ ++ 15:11:47 Jan 28 is our feature proposal freeze 15:12:19 if you anticipate some blockers, please give us a heads up so we can adjust plans 15:13:27 there's a proposal for the Zorilla cycle schedule while we're at this 15:13:33 #link https://review.opendev.org/c/openstack/releases/+/824489 (WIP: Proposed release schedule for Z (27w)) 15:14:54 two dates to track from there: April 04-08, 2022 is the proposed PTG week and 7th - 9th June, 2022 is the Summit 15:15:49 when this is merged, we'll get the manila specific deadlines added 15:16:10 that's all the announcements i had for today, anyone else got any? 15:17:37 #topic Reviews needing attention 15:17:44 #link https://etherpad.opendev.org/p/manila-yoga-review-focus 15:19:35 #link https://review.opendev.org/c/openstack/manila/+/808131 (Follow up SVM Migrate change) 15:20:14 this is mostly test coverage enhancement and a couple of docstring adjustments 15:21:07 i suppose carloss wanted to see the netapp ci passing on this, and perhaps for a change of ownership? 15:21:33 yep... I remember also talking with fabiooliveira about this change :) 15:21:33 i can take a look on it - or find someone to help me 👀 15:21:50 the thing is that we are hitting intermittent issues on the py39 job 15:23:17 thanks fabiooliveira :) 15:23:35 thanks; it'd be nice to close this out and backport it 15:24:02 it's basically unit tests... the NetApp CI has no much importance here 15:24:33 our CI is currently facing some issues 15:24:44 we're focus on fix it 15:24:52 ack; i'd like some +1s from you folks to be confident its good to go 15:25:07 nice, I'll have a look too 15:25:24 i see a import of "six" that'll disappoint haixin :) so it might need an update too 15:25:52 :) 15:25:59 on the six removal change 15:26:06 from drivers and their unit tests 15:26:18 #link https://review.opendev.org/c/openstack/manila/+/821162 15:26:35 * carloss is in the middle of the review for this 15:27:24 or we can remove in another patch? 15:27:32 remove six 15:28:28 I'm reviewing the patch, this one, I think the NetApp CI should be passing 15:29:09 s/passing/voting/ 15:29:16 great thanks, just saw fabiooliveira's comment as well 15:29:57 haixin: yes; in the final patch, i'm tempted to add a hacking test to ensure there are no more "import six" statements and call it done 15:30:57 fabiooliveira: the answer to your question is this: https://review.opendev.org/c/openstack/manila/+/756991 15:32:10 any other changes that need to be discussed here? 15:33:31 oh wait, i skipped past a new addition 15:33:40 https://review.opendev.org/c/openstack/manila-specs/+/823165 (Add automatic snapshots creation/deletion policies) 15:33:45 #link https://review.opendev.org/c/openstack/manila-specs/+/823165 (Add automatic snapshots creation/deletion policies) 15:34:00 this one was submitted past our spec deadline 15:34:08 and still targets yoga 15:34:27 * dviroel "Zorilla cycle"++ 15:35:07 yes, a good candidate for the zorilla cycle :) 15:35:36 n 15:36:09 gouthamr: i was quoting your Zorilla cycle from above, hope that wins 15:36:15 and a worthy enhancement - i don't mind keeping it on the review etherpad at the end since its a spec; the authors haven't requested an exception, but i'll let them know to retarget it 15:37:09 dviroel: ah :) lets make it happen 15:37:19 sure \o/ 15:37:36 * gouthamr thinks there was a proposal to allow community voting on naming again 15:37:58 gouthamr, got my vote :) 15:38:07 mine too 15:39:20 :) we've a good voting block with some canvassing 15:39:40 alright, lets move on to bug triage with vhari 15:39:58 #topic Bug Triage (vhari) 15:40:06 gouthamr, o/ 15:40:26 * vhari diving into it 15:40:28 #link https://bugs.launchpad.net/manila/+bug/1958193 15:40:29 obviously has my vote 15:41:40 ah 15:42:17 I checked the CI to see if this failure is also happening but it doesn't seem to be 15:42:29 yes, because we pull python-manilaclient from source 15:42:34 caiquemello[m] said he is also facing this issue 15:42:36 it's happening in our CI 15:42:39 oh 15:42:47 we are providing a fix for it 15:42:48 you'll need a fix like this: https://review.opendev.org/c/openinfra/python-tempestconf/+/817948 15:43:10 does the latest python-manilaclient from PyPI have OSC share group type implemented? 15:43:15 it doesn't 15:43:25 and we could remedy that and request a release 15:43:27 that's probably why then 15:43:43 temporary fix: LIBS_FROM_GIT=python-manilaclient 15:43:46 gouthamr: yeap 15:43:53 lets do the release 15:44:24 nothing preventing us from releasing as many times as we need to 15:44:51 the next "scheduled" release was going to be alongside milestone-3 (Feb 25th) 15:45:54 vhari: for our bookkeeping, this isn't really a bug in manila, just devstack would do 15:46:20 gouthamr, ack 15:46:47 although the fix wouldn't be in devstack either - it'd be a release for python-manilaclient that we'd tag, or a workaround like ecsantos[m] mentions above 15:47:11 i suspect Jacob's running into this with his CI too 15:47:56 its possible to hit this with local devstacks too 15:48:16 but, we recommend getting python-manilaclient from source 15:48:18 #link https://docs.openstack.org/manila/latest/_downloads/42245fd942d8a3ac38aa3aebbc9c2ad1/lvm_local.conf 15:48:22 ^ example 15:49:44 gouthamr, we need someone to follow up with ^^ and track the change .. 15:50:00 i will in just a bit.. 15:50:13 gouthamr, by M-3 15:51:03 or sooner :) 15:51:25 yep, that's the idea :) 15:51:29 we can set the bug against manila to invalid since no code fix is necessary in manila; but i'll follow up with the release and comment on the bug 15:51:44 gouthamr++ 15:51:49 gouthamr++ 15:52:08 gouthamr++ 15:52:30 next up a doc bug for minor triage 15:52:31 #link https://bugs.launchpad.net/manila/+bug/1958072 15:54:56 and a minor fix too 15:55:02 yep 15:55:16 seems like a "low" low-hanging-fruit bug to me vhari 15:55:33 ++ 15:55:34 ++ 15:55:36 i can find someone to do it 👀 15:55:49 can i work on this? 15:55:49 fabiooliveira: thanks; all yours! 15:56:17 archana can take it, if she want to, no problem :D 15:56:35 awesome; thanks archanaserver fabiooliveira 15:56:42 thanks fabiooliveira :) 15:56:43 verdict goes to archanaserver :) 15:56:52 thanks fabiooliveira and archanaserver 15:57:13 gouthamr, that's a wrap for bugs 15:57:26 thanks vhari 15:57:32 #topic Open Discussion 15:57:34 yw 15:59:31 alright, lets take any further discussion to #openstack-manila 15:59:34 thank you all for joining 15:59:41 see you here next week! 15:59:48 #endmeeting